20 MSMEs from UP listed on NSE, BSE last year

Lucknow, June 24 (KNN) In the past year, 20 Uttar Pradesh MSMEs have been listed on the National Stock Exchange (NSE) and Bombay Stock Exchange (BSE).

Out of the twenty companies that have been listed, twelve companies worth of Rs 129 crore have been listed on the BSE while eight companies with a total net worth of Rs 101 crore were listed on the NSE.

Additional chief secretary, MSME and Khadi, Navneet Sehgal, said that the government will soon arrange a virtual interaction of FICCI and Laghu Udyog Bharti with NSE and BSE so that more companies could be encouraged to get listed on the stock exchange.

“Uttar Pradesh has 55 lakh demat accounts which is third largest in the country,” he added.

Sehgal held a meeting with Royal Benjamin, north India manager of the BSE and Rakesh Kumar Khurana, senior manager of the NSE on Thursday. During the meeting, it was decided that companies established in the last five years would get preference for listing on the stock exchange.

The state government is ready to provide all the necessary assistance to the companies that wish to be listed on the stock exchange.

Apart from this, the state government will also help list companies trading in ODOP products on the stock exchange.  (KNN Bureau)
